What is the relationship between migration and higher education in Mexico?
Migration can affect higher education in Mexico by influencing the decisions of students and professionals to seek academic and work opportunities abroad. This can lead to brain drain and the loss of qualified human talent, as well as the adoption of strategies to retain and attract students and academics in the country.
How does the identification of PEP affect commercial and financial relations in Colombia?
Identification of PEPs may result in stricter procedures and oversight by financial institutions. Although it may generate more complex processes for PEPs and their associates, this measure is crucial to guarantee transparency and legality in commercial and financial transactions in Colombia.
How is financial fraud prevented and combated in regulatory compliance in Peru?
The prevention and combat of financial fraud in Peru is based on the implementation of internal controls, financial audits, and the monitoring of suspicious transactions to comply with regulations such as the Money Laundering and Terrorist Financing Law.

How is the crime of drug trafficking penalized in Guatemala?
Drug trafficking in Guatemala can be punished with severe prison sentences. The legislation seeks to prevent and punish the illegal production, distribution or sale of controlled substances, protecting public health and combating drug trafficking.
What are the requirements to challenge paternity in Mexican civil law?
The requirements include presenting evidence that refutes established paternity, following the corresponding judicial procedure and respecting the deadlines established by law.
